Transamerica settles 401(k) excessive fees case

June 29, 2016

By InvestmentNews

Transamerica Corp. has agreed to settle an excessive fees suit with participants in its own 401(k) plan for $3.8 million. Plaintiffs in the suit, Lequita Dennard et al v. Transamerica Corp. et al, allege breach of fiduciary duty under the Employee Retirement Income Security Act of 1974 by Transamerica and affiliated companies for charging excessive administrative and investment management fees.
